Nicolas Pitre704bdda02006-01-14 16:33:50 +0000884config AEABI
885 bool "Use the ARM EABI to compile the kernel"
886 help
887 This option allows for the kernel to be compiled using the latest
888 ARM ABI (aka EABI). This is only useful if you are using a user
889 space environment that is also compiled with EABI.
890
891 Since there are major incompatibilities between the legacy ABI and
892 EABI, especially with regard to structure member alignment, this
893 option also changes the kernel syscall calling convention to
894 disambiguate both ABIs and allow for backward compatibility support
895 (selected with CONFIG_OABI_COMPAT).
896
897 To use this you need GCC version 4.0.0 or later.
898
Nicolas Pitre6c90c872006-01-14 16:37:15 +0000899config OABI_COMPAT
Russell Kinga73a3ff2006-02-08 21:09:55 +0000900 bool "Allow old ABI binaries to run with this kernel (EXPERIMENTAL)"
Nicolas Pitre61c484d2006-02-08 21:09:08 +0000901 depends on AEABI && EXPERIMENTAL
Nicolas Pitre6c90c872006-01-14 16:37:15 +0000902 default y
903 help
904 This option preserves the old syscall interface along with the
905 new (ARM EABI) one. It also provides a compatibility layer to
906 intercept syscalls that have structure arguments which layout
907 in memory differs between the legacy ABI and the new ARM EABI
908 (only for non "thumb" binaries). This option adds a tiny
909 overhead to all syscalls and produces a slightly larger kernel.
910 If you know you'll be using only pure EABI user space then you
911 can say N here. If this option is not selected and you attempt
912 to execute a legacy ABI binary then the result will be
913 UNPREDICTABLE (in fact it can be predicted that it won't work
914 at all). If in doubt say Y.

995config ALIGNMENT_TRAP
996 bool
Hyok S. Choif12d0d72006-09-26 17:36:37 +0900997 depends on CPU_CP15_MMU
Linus Torvalds1da177e2005-04-16 15:20:36 -0700998 default y if !ARCH_EBSA110
999 help
Matt LaPlante84eb8d02006-10-03 22:53:09 +02001000 ARM processors cannot fetch/store information which is not
Linus Torvalds1da177e2005-04-16 15:20:36 -07001001 naturally aligned on the bus, i.e., a 4 byte fetch must start at an
1002 address divisible by 4. On 32-bit ARM processors, these non-aligned
1003 fetch/store instructions will be emulated in software if you say
1004 here, which has a severe performance impact. This is necessary for
1005 correct operation of some network protocols. With an IP-only
1006 configuration it is safe to say N, otherwise say Y.

1059 Execute-In-Place allows the kernel to run from non-volatile storage
1060 directly addressable by the CPU, such as NOR flash. This saves RAM
1061 space since the text section of the kernel is not loaded from flash
1062 to RAM. Read-write sections, such as the data section and stack,
1063 are still copied to RAM. The XIP kernel is not compressed since
1064 it has to run directly from flash, so it will take more space to
1065 store it. The flash address used to link the kernel object files,
1066 and for storing it, is configuration dependent. Therefore, if you
1067 say Y here, you must know the proper physical address where to
1068 store the kernel image depending on your own flash memory usage.
1069
1070 Also note that the make target becomes "make xipImage" rather than
1071 "make zImage" or "make Image". The final kernel binary to put in
1072 ROM memory will be arch/arm/boot/xipImage.
1073
1074 If unsure, say N.
